The Keenan Raiders will head out on the road to square off against the Horse Creek Academy Stallions at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Keenan is coming into the match on a three-game losing streak.
Keenan's offense might be in the hot seat on Tuesday considering what happened against Eau Claire on Monday. They wound up on the wrong side of a rough 7-0 walloping at the hands of the Shamrocks.
Meanwhile, it may have taken extra minutes to finish the job, but Horse Creek Academy ultimately got the result they hoped for on Thursday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 2-1 win over Mead Hall Episcopal School. The victory was some much needed relief for Horse Creek Academy as it spelled an end to their seven-game losing streak.
They were led to victory by the tag-team duo of
Tyler Simpkins and
Isaiah Thomas, who scored both of Horse Creek Academy's goals. The pair have combined for a total of six so far this season.
Keenan now has a losing record at 6-7. As for Horse Creek Academy, their win ended a four-game drought at home and bumped them up to 3-9.
